Nurse Anesthetist Salary in Midland, TX: $243,407 (2026)
Quick Answer:A full-time nurse anesthetist in Midland, TX earns a median $243,407/year (≈ $117.02/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 — proj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 29-1151). Once you factor in Midland's price level (4% below national, BEA RPP 96.0), that paycheck buys what $253,549 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 0.2% below the Texas state average.

Salary Breakdown
| Percentile | Annual | Hourly |
|---|---|---|
| Entry Level (P10) | $161,524 | $77.66 |
| Lower Range (P25) | $213,262 | $102.53 |
| Median (P50)(typical) | $243,407 | $117.02 |
| Upper Range (P75) | $307,390 | $147.78 |
| Top Earners (P90) | $357,041 | $171.65 |

Salary Trajectory for Nurse Anesthetists in Midland (2019–2027)
2019–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 5.20% projection.
| Year | Annual Salary |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2019 | $170,937 | Actual |
| 2020 | $179,533 | Actual |
| 2021 | $191,298 | Actual |
| 2022 | $198,613 | Actual |
| 2023 | $207,963 | Actual |
| 2024 | $206,004 | Actual |
| 2025 | $231,375 |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$243,407 | Estimated |
| 2027 | $256,064 | Projected |
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for the Midland metropolitan area, the median nurse anesthetist salary grew 35.4% from $170,937 (2019) to $231,375 (2025). At a 5.20% compound annual growth rate, salaries are projected to reach $256,064 by 2027 — a total increase of $85,127 (49.80%) from 2019.
Note: Historical values (2019–2025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Midland met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 2026–2026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 5.20% CAGR derived from 7-year BLS historical data. Nurse Anesthetist Job Market in Midland
The job market for nurse anesthetists in Midland is characterized by a relatively small number of professionals, with only 27 currently employed. The cost of living index for Midland stands at 96, suggesting that the purchasing power of salaries stretched further than in many other regions. Among the local employers, those operating within hospital systems or engaging CRNAs through ambulatory surgery centers typically offer higher compensation, while independent group practices may provide partnership opportunities that can lead to significant earnings. Factors influencing the disparity in pay include the intricacies of call coverage, weekend and holiday differentials, and the structure of payment models such as W-2 versus 1099 employment. To maximize earnings in Midland, professionals should consider roles with varied on-call expectations and those that offer productivity bonuses or pathway options toward ownership in anesthesia groups.
